Quilt Blocks:
1. Flower of quilter's choice.
2. Style of block will be quilter's choice (paper piece, applique, embroidery, whatever); same fabric throughout will tie it together.
3. Quilter will receive 4 fat quarters of same 4 fabric to use. Must use at least one of the pastels for the background and the green for some of the leaves. They can then add their own choice to finish their block. Must use good quality 100% cotton.
4. All fabric must be pre washed.
5. Block Size: Eight inches (make oversize).
6. Each block will be left oversize for piecing together ease.
